Instructions. Bring the water to a boil, then add salt. Gradually whisk in the cornmeal. Reduce the heat to low and cook, whisking often, till the mixture thickens and the cornmeal is tender, about 15 to 20 minutes. Take the pan off the heat and whisk in the cheese, milk, butter, and parsley.

This classic dish made from cornmeal is a staple food from the regions of Northern and Central Italy. History tells us that the earlier version was made with other grains such as farro, millet, spelt, chestnut flour, and chickpeas.

Polenta is a traditional Italian dish made of cooked cornmeal that's typically flavored with butter and Parmesan. When it's freshly made, it is creamy and pourable. As it cools, it becomes firm enough to slice. Italians often cut leftover polenta into squares and fry or grill them as an appetizer.

Uncooked Polenta: Polenta is made from cornmeal. I recommend using stone-ground, coarse, or medium-ground cornmeal. Try to avoid using fine ground or instant polenta because it will turn out like a thick paste. Butter: I used unsalted butter in this recipe. Parmesan Cheese: Parmesan cheese adds a salty, nutty flavor. Don't leave it out!
